Former Kenyan presidential candidate Mohamed Abduba Dida famously known as Mwalimu Dida is currently serving a jail term of seven years in the United States after being convicted in 2022.

To the shock of many Kenyans, Mwalimu Dida has been in prison since November 18, 2022 when he was convicted on two separate accounts at the Big Muddy Correctional Center in Illinois.

On the first account he was found guilty of stalking and intimidating his victim for which he was handed two years in jail and on the second account he was found guilty of failure to respect restrain orders from his victim for which he was handed five years imprisonment.

The former teacher ran unsuccessful campaigns for Kenya’s presidency in 2013 and 2017 but finished ahead of some well-established politicians.

News about his sentencing came as a shock to many Kenyans due to the values and principles he held during his campaigns. However, seemingly, he carries his vocal demeanor to prison as sources indicate that he has sued the prison facility over violations of his rights as a prisoner.

Dida has complained about violation of his religious rights being allowed only one Friday prayer and no prayer before and after sunset. Furthermore, despite his request for a full shower on Friday before prayer, he has been offered none indicating in his petition that even a drop of urine would nullify his prayer.

The former Kenya’s presidential candidate who apparently was in the US for a doctoral program in psychology is scheduled to be released on April 3, 2029.
